Pericardial Mesothelioma and asbestos litigation Exposure

Pericardial mesothelioma can be a rare type of mesothelioma, which is found in the lining of the heart (pericardium). This type of mesothelioma generally causes symptoms like chest pain or fatigue that may mimic other health conditions.

These symptoms can take years to develop after exposure to asbestos which makes a diagnosis difficult. The best method to obtain a correct diagnosis is for patients to discuss their experience of asbestos exposure with their physician.

What is the cause of Pericardial Mesothelioma?

Pericardial Mesothelioma is a cancer that grows in the thin membrane that lines the heart. This is a rare form of mesothelioma, which can be found in 1% to 2 % of all cases. Similar to mesothelioma types, pericardial mesothelioma is connected to asbestos exposure.

Asbestos is a type of naturally found mineral that was used in many common household and commercial products for decades. The fibers are easily inhaled, swallowed, or caught in the linings of the abdominal and chest cavities. Mesothelioma develops when the fibrils cause irritation and then form tumors.

Diagnosis

Diagnosing pericardial mesothelioma can be difficult. Its symptoms are often akin to other heart conditions that are more common and may not show up until the disease has progressed in a significant way. Asbestos exposure can occur years before pericardial msothelioma can be diagnosed, making it difficult to identify the connection. Anyone who has a history of asbestos exposure should consult their physician about any signs that could be related to asbestos lawyer.

The cause of mesothelioma pericardial remains unclear, but doctors believe that it occurs when asbestos fibers move from the lungs to the pericardium and cause irritation to the tissues there. Over time the tissues affected by irritation transform into cancerous cells which develop into tumors. The pericardium is filled with fluid around the heart due to the tumors and the resulting pressure causes stress on the organ and leads to symptoms.

X-rays or CT scans are usually done by doctors first to identify any signs of tumors or excess fluids. Then, they conduct tests of blood to confirm the presence of mesothelioma and determine the extent of any spreading of cancerous cells.

Pericardial Mesothelioma, one of the rarest forms of mesothelioma that accounts for less than one percent of all mesothelioma cases diagnosed. This is due in part to the difficulty in identifying this condition because it can be a symptom of other heart diseases and symptoms.

The first stage in the diagnosis process is a physical examination by an expert physician who listens to the patient's breathing and heartbeat. The doctor may also order a CT or MRI scan of the chest to detect tumors and to identify areas of swelling. If they detect fluid in the pericardium, they will order an echocardiogram. This will be used to evaluate the heart's function and see whether the lining has become thicker.

After the doctor has determined there is a tumor or a fluid buildup in the pericardium they will perform a biopsy in order to confirm their diagnosis and determine if it is malignant. During a biopsy doctors will take small amounts of tissue or fluid and send them to a lab for further testing.

Since pericardial mesothelioma is a more limited range of treatment options than other types, a majority of sufferers will not recover from the cancer. However, there are new treatment methods being explored that could offer better outcomes for patients. Gene therapy is one of these methods. It involves introducing or removing certain genes from the body of a patient in order to combat certain diseases. Another option is immunotherapy, which aims to build a patient's immune system to fight cancer.
